Importance of Physical Fitness

Physical fitness is a crucial aspect of overall well-being, contributing to both physical and mental health. When you're physically fit, you enjoy increased energy levels, improved immune function, and reduced risk of chronic diseases such as heart disease, stroke, and type 2 diabetes.

Physical fitness also promotes mental well-being by releasing endorphins, which have mood-boosting effects. It can reduce stress, anxiety, and depression while improving cognitive function and sleep quality.

Components of Physical Fitness

Physical fitness encompasses five key components: cardiovascular endurance, muscular strength, muscular endurance, flexibility, and body composition.

  • Cardiovascular endurance measures your body's ability to deliver oxygen and nutrients to muscles during sustained physical activity, such as running or swimming.
  • Muscular strength refers to the force your muscles can generate during a single maximum effort, like lifting weights.
  • Muscular endurance indicates how long your muscles can exert force repeatedly without fatiguing, as tested through exercises like push-ups.
  • Flexibility measures your range of motion around your joints, which is essential for everyday activities and injury prevention.
  • Body composition refers to the ratio of muscle, fat, and bone in your body, which affects overall health and fitness.

Benefits of Physical Fitness

  • Improved heart health and reduced risk of cardiovascular disease
  • Stronger muscles and bones, reducing the risk of falls and fractures
  • Increased flexibility, which enhances mobility and reduces pain
  • Improved mental health and well-being
  • Reduced risk of chronic diseases like type 2 diabetes
  • Increased energy levels and overall vitality
  • Improved sleep quality

How to Improve Physical Fitness

Incorporating regular exercise into your routine is the key to improving physical fitness. Follow these steps:

  1. Set realistic goals: Don't try to do too much too soon; start with small, achievable goals and gradually increase intensity and duration over time.
  2. Choose activities you enjoy: This will make exercise feel less like a chore and more like something you look forward to.
  3. Make exercise a habit: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ity aerobic activity per week.
  4. Include strength training: Incorporate exercises like push-ups, squats, and lunges to improve muscular strength and endurance.
  5. Stretch regularly: Stretching after workouts and on off days helps improve flexibility and reduce stiffness.
  6. Monitor your progress: Track your workouts, repetitions, and weight to assess your progress and make adjustments as needed.
  7. Listen to your body: Rest when you need to, and don't push yourself too hard. If you experience any pain or discomfort, stop exercising and consult a healthcare professional.
